Kontrol Paneli Seçerken Dikkat Edilmesi Gerekenler
Kontrol Paneli Nedir?
Kontrol paneli, sunucu yönetimi görevlerini web tabanlı bir arayüz aracılığıyla kolaylaştıran bir yazılımdır. Bu paneller, alan adı yönetimi, e-posta hesapları oluşturma, veritabanı işlemleri, dosya transferleri ve güvenlik ayarları gibi karmaşık sunucu komutlarını kullanıcı dostu görsellerle temsil eder. cPanel, Plesk ve DirectAdmin gibi popüler seçenekler, sunucu altyapısını daha erişilebilir hale getirerek, teknik uzmanlık gerektiren işlemleri basitleştirir.
Kontrol Paneli Nasıl Çalışır?
Kontrol panelleri, sunucuda çalışan arka plan servisleriyle etkileşim kurarak çalışır. Temel işleyiş mekanizması şu adımları içerir:
- Kullanıcı Arayüzü (UI): Kullanıcı, web tarayıcısı aracılığıyla kontrol paneline erişir. Bu arayüz, menüler, sekmeler ve formlar aracılığıyla çeşitli yönetim işlevlerini sunar.
- API ve Arka Plan Servisleri: Kullanıcıdan gelen komutlar, kontrol paneli yazılımının kendi API'si aracılığıyla sunucudaki ilgili servisleri (örneğin Apache, Nginx, MySQL, Postfix) tetikler.
- Sunucu Komutları: Kontrol paneli, arka planda standart sunucu komutlarını (örneğin `adduser`, `createdb`, `chmod`) çalıştırarak istenen işlemi gerçekleştirir. Bu komutlar, sunucu işletim sisteminin (Linux, Windows) sunduğu araçlarla entegre çalışır.
- Geri Bildirim: İşlem tamamlandığında, kontrol paneli sonucu kullanıcı arayüzünde güncellenmiş bilgiler veya başarı/hata mesajları ile gösterir.
Bu yapı, kullanıcının doğrudan komut satırına erişmesine veya karmaşık yapılandırma dosyalarını düzenlemesine gerek kalmadan sunucu kaynaklarını etkin bir şekilde yönetmesini sağlar. Sistem mimarisi genellikle bir web sunucusu (Apache, Nginx), bir veritabanı (MySQL, PostgreSQL) ve kontrol paneli yazılımının kendisinden oluşur.
Kontrol Paneli Türleri
Piyasada farklı ihtiyaçlara ve bütçelere hitap eden çeşitli kontrol paneli türleri bulunmaktadır. Bu çeşitlilik, kullanıcıların en uygun çözümü bulmalarını sağlar.
- cPanel/WHM: En yaygın kullanılan Linux tabanlı kontrol panelidir. Genellikle paylaşımlı hosting, VPS ve dedicated sunucular için tercih edilir. WHM (Web Host Manager) ise daha çok hosting sağlayıcıları tarafından müşteri hesaplarını yönetmek için kullanılır.
- Plesk: Hem Linux hem de Windows işletim sistemlerini destekleyen, çok yönlü bir kontrol panelidir. Geniş özellik seti ve modern arayüzü ile bilinir.
- DirectAdmin: Hafifliği, hızı ve nispeten daha düşük maliyeti ile öne çıkan bir kontrol panelidir. Özellikle performans odaklı kullanıcılar tarafından tercih edilir.
- CyberPanel: Ücretsiz ve açık kaynaklı bir kontrol panelidir. LiteSpeed web sunucusu ile entegre olarak gelir ve yüksek performans sunar.
- Webmin/Virtualmin: Açık kaynaklı ve ücretsiz alternatiflerdir. Daha teknik kullanıcılar için esneklik sunar, ancak başlangıç seviyesindeki kullanıcılar için öğrenme eğrisi daha dik olabilir.
Karşılaştırma tablosu aşağıdadır:
| Panel Adı | İşletim Sistemi Desteği | Lisans Modeli | Genel Kullanım Alanı | Öne Çıkan Özellikler |
|---|---|---|---|---|
| cPanel/WHM | Linux | Ücretli | Hosting Sağlayıcıları, Orta/Büyük Ölçekli İşletmeler | Geniş özellik seti, kullanıcı dostu WHM |
| Plesk | Linux, Windows | Ücretli | Hosting Sağlayıcıları, Kurumsal Kullanıcılar | Çoklu OS desteği, modern arayüz |
| DirectAdmin | Linux | Ücretli | Performans Odaklı Kullanıcılar, Küçük/Orta Ölçekli İşletmeler | Hafif, hızlı, uygun maliyetli |
| CyberPanel | Linux | Ücretsiz (Açık Kaynak) | Performans Odaklı Bireysel Kullanıcılar, Geliştiriciler | LiteSpeed entegrasyonu, ücretsiz |
Kontrol Paneli Seçim Kriterleri
Doğru kontrol panelini seçmek, uzun vadeli sunucu yönetimi başarısı için temeldir. Aşağıdaki faktörler dikkate alınmalıdır:
- İşletim Sistemi Uyumluluğu: Sunucunuzda kurulu olan veya kurmayı planladığınız işletim sistemini (Linux dağıtımları, Windows Server sürümleri) destekleyen bir panel seçilmelidir.
- Kullanım Kolaylığı ve Arayüz: Panelin arayüzünün ne kadar sezgisel ve kullanıcı dostu olduğu önemlidir. Teknik seviyeniz ne olursa olsun, sık kullandığınız işlemlere kolayca erişebilmeniz gerekir.
- Özellik Seti: İhtiyaç duyduğunuz temel (domain, e-posta, veritabanı yönetimi) ve gelişmiş (otomatik yedekleme, SSL sertifikası yönetimi, güvenlik duvarı yapılandırması, uygulama yükleyiciler) özellikleri sunup sunmadığını kontrol edin.
- Performans ve Kaynak Tüketimi: Özellikle paylaşımlı veya VPS sunucularda, panelin kendisinin sunucu kaynaklarını (CPU, RAM) ne kadar tükettiği önemlidir. Hafif paneller genellikle daha iyi performans sunar.
- Güvenlik Özellikleri: Panel, yerleşik güvenlik duvarı, saldırı tespit sistemleri, otomatik güncelleme mekanizmaları gibi özellikler sunmalı veya bu tür entegrasyonlara izin vermelidir.
- Maliyet ve Lisanslama: Panellerin lisans modelleri (tek seferlik satın alma, aylık/yıllık abonelik) ve maliyetleri bütçenize uygun olmalıdır. Açık kaynaklı ücretsiz seçenekler de değerlendirilebilir.
- Belgelendirme ve Destek: Kapsamlı dokümantasyon, topluluk forumları ve ücretli destek seçenekleri, sorunlarla karşılaştığınızda çözüm bulmanızı kolaylaştırır.
- Genişletilebilirlik ve Eklentiler: İhtiyaç duyabileceğiniz ek işlevler için eklenti veya modül desteği olup olmadığını kontrol edin.
Kontrol Paneli Kurulumu
Kontrol paneli kurulumu, sunucu yönetimi süreçlerinin ilk ve en önemli adımlarından biridir. Doğru kurulum, paneli verimli ve güvenli bir şekilde kullanmanızı sağlar. Farklı kontrol panelleri için kurulum adımları değişiklik gösterebilir. Genel olarak, kurulum süreci aşağıdaki adımları içerir:
- Sunucu Hazırlığı: Kurulum yapılacak sunucunun güncel bir işletim sistemine sahip olması, gerekli paketlerin (örneğin `wget`, `curl`) yüklü olması ve güvenlik duvarının doğru şekilde yapılandırılması gerekir.
- Kurulum Dosyalarının İndirilmesi: Kontrol panelinin resmi web sitesinden kurulum betiği (script) indirilir.
- Kurulum Betiğinin Çalıştırılması: İndirilen betik, SSH üzerinden sunucuda çalıştırılır. Bu aşamada lisans bilgileri veya bazı temel yapılandırma seçenekleri sorulabilir.
- Yapılandırma: Kurulum tamamlandıktan sonra, web sunucusu, veritabanı sunucusu ve posta sunucusu gibi temel servisler yapılandırılır.
- Erişim ve İlk Ayarlar: Kurulum tamamlandığında, kontrol paneline web tarayıcısı üzerinden erişilir. İlk giriş sonrası kullanıcı adı, şifre ve temel güvenlik ayarları yapılır.
Detaylı kurulum adımları için Kontrol Paneli Kurulumu makalesini inceleyebilirsiniz.
Temel Kontrol Paneli Yönetim Görevleri
Kontrol panelleri, sunucu yönetimini basitleştirerek çeşitli operasyonel görevleri kolaylaştırır. Bu görevler, sunucunun sağlıklı çalışmasını sağlamak ve barındırılan web sitelerinin erişilebilirliğini korumak için gereklidir.
- Alan Adı Yönetimi: Yeni alan adları ekleme, mevcut alan adlarını yönetme, DNS kayıtlarını yapılandırma.
- E-posta Yönetimi: E-posta hesapları oluşturma, silme, şifrelerini değiştirme, posta listeleri yönetme, spam filtrelerini yapılandırma.
- Veritabanı Yönetimi: Yeni veritabanları oluşturma, mevcut veritabanlarını yönetme, kullanıcı yetkilerini ayarlama, veritabanı yedeklerini alma. phpMyAdmin veya benzeri araçlarla entegrasyon sağlar.
- Dosya Yönetimi: Dosya yöneticisi aracılığıyla dosya ve klasörleri yükleme, indirme, taşıma, silme ve izinlerini değiştirme. FTP hesabı yönetimi de bu kapsamdadır.
- Yazılım Kurulumu ve Yönetimi: Popüler web uygulamaları (WordPress, Joomla, Drupal gibi) için tek tıklamayla kurulum seçenekleri sunabilir.
- Güvenlik Ayarları: SSL sertifikası yükleme/yenileme, güvenlik duvarı kuralları oluşturma, hotlink koruması, dizin şifreleme gibi güvenlik önlemlerini uygulama.
- Yedekleme ve Geri Yükleme: Otomatik yedekleme planları oluşturma, yedekleri yönetme ve gerektiğinde sunucuyu veya belirli dosyaları önceki bir duruma geri yükleme.
- Kullanıcı ve Yetki Yönetimi: Farklı kullanıcılar için hesaplar oluşturma ve bunlara belirli yetkiler atama.
Sık Yapılan Hatalar ve Çözümleri
Kontrol paneli seçimi ve yönetimi sırasında yapılan bazı yaygın hatalar, operasyonel sorunlara yol açabilir. Bu hataların farkında olmak ve önleyici tedbirler almak önemlidir.
- Yanlış Panel Seçimi: İhtiyaçları tam olarak karşılamayan veya gereğinden fazla karmaşık bir panel seçmek, yönetim zorluklarına neden olur. Çözüm: İhtiyaçlarınızı net bir şekilde belirleyin ve farklı panellerin özelliklerini karşılaştırın.
- Güvenlik Güncellemelerini Atlamak: Kontrol paneli ve sunucu yazılımlarının güncel tutulmaması, güvenlik açıklarına yol açar. Çözüm: Otomatik güncelleme özelliklerini etkinleştirin veya düzenli olarak manuel güncelleme yapın.
- Yetersiz Yedekleme Stratejisi: Düzenli ve test edilmiş yedeklerin alınmaması, veri kaybı durumunda ciddi sorunlara yol açar. Çözüm: Otomatik yedekleme planları oluşturun ve yedeklerin geri yüklenebilirliğini periyodik olarak test edin.
- Karmaşık Şifre Politikası Eksikliği: Zayıf şifreler kullanmak veya şifreleri düzenli olarak değiştirmemek, hesapların ele geçirilme riskini artırır. Çözüm: Karmaşık ve benzersiz şifreler kullanın ve iki faktörlü kimlik doğrulamayı (2FA) etkinleştirin.
- Kaynak Monitörlüğü Yapmamak: Sunucu kaynaklarının (CPU, RAM, disk alanı) düzenli olarak izlenmemesi, performans sorunlarına veya hizmet kesintilerine neden olabilir. Çözüm: Paneldeki veya ek araçlarla sunulan kaynak monitörleme özelliklerini kullanın.
- Yetersiz Belgelendirme: Panel özelliklerinin ve yönetim süreçlerinin belgelenmemesi, ekip üyeleri arasında bilgi tutarsızlığına yol açar. Çözüm: Önemli yapılandırmaları ve prosedürleri belgeleyin.
Teknik Özellikler ve Standartlar
Kontrol panelleri, çeşitli teknik standartlar ve protokoller üzerine inşa edilmiştir. Bu standartlara uyum, panellerin diğer sistemlerle entegrasyonunu ve güvenliğini sağlar.
- Web Sunucuları: Apache (HTTP/1.1, HTTP/2), Nginx, LiteSpeed gibi web sunucularıyla entegre çalışırlar.
- Veritabanları: MySQL, MariaDB, PostgreSQL gibi popüler veritabanı sistemlerini desteklerler.
- E-posta Protokolleri: SMTP, POP3, IMAP gibi standart e-posta protokollerini kullanır ve yönetirler.
- Güvenlik: SSL/TLS sertifikaları (Let's Encrypt, SNI), SSH erişimi, FTP/SFTP, IP tabanlı erişim kısıtlamaları gibi güvenlik mekanizmalarını desteklerler.
- Dosya Sistemleri: Linux dosya sistemi izinleri (chmod, chown) ve Windows ACL'ler ile uyumlu çalışırlar.
- API Entegrasyonu: Bazı paneller, otomasyon ve özel entegrasyonlar için RESTful API'ler sunar.
2026 Sektör Verileri ve İstatistikler
Web hosting ve sunucu yönetimi pazarındaki büyüme, kontrol panellerinin kullanımını doğrudan etkilemektedir. Sektördeki güncel eğilimler hakkında fikir edinmek, doğru teknoloji seçimleri için önemlidir.
W3Techs 2026 verilerine göre, web sitelerinin yaklaşık %45'i WordPress kullanmaktadır ve bu trend, WordPress ile uyumlu kontrol panellerinin popülerliğini artırmaktadır. Statista 2026 raporuna göre, küresel bulut bilişim pazarı 1 trilyon doları aşmıştır ve bu, yönetilebilir sunucu çözümlerine olan talebi yükseltmektedir. Cloudflare Radar 2026 verilerine göre, internet trafiğinin büyük bir kısmı (%70'ten fazlası) mobil cihazlardan gelmektedir, bu da hızlı ve optimize edilmiş web sitelerine olan ihtiyacı ve dolayısıyla sunucu yönetimi araçlarının önemini vurgular. Netcraft 2026 araştırmasına göre, aktif web sitesi sayısı 2 milyarı aşmıştır, bu da sunucu yönetimi için etkili kontrol panellerinin kritikliğini göstermektedir.
İlgili Konular
Kontrol paneli yönetimi hakkında daha fazla bilgi edinmek için, Kontrol Paneli Kurulumu makalesini inceleyebilirsiniz. Bu makale, sunucuya kontrol paneli kurulumunun temel adımlarını detaylandırmaktadır.

